PureMessage for Windows/Exchange: hourly spam rule updates available
Hourly updates to your PureMessage spam rules are now available, direct from Sophos. Hourly updates provide increased protection against the latest spamming techniques.
The increased frequency of updates will take place automatically, you do not have to reconfigure your software. However, if you have concerns about the load on your internet connection, you can reduce the frequency of updates as described below.
What to do
To reduce the frequency of updates, do as follows:
- On your management computer, where the PureMessage console is installed, locate the Sophos AutoUpdate icon (the blue shield) in the system tray.
- Right-click the icon to display a menu, and select 'Configure updating'.
- Click the 'Schedule' tab and select 'Enable automatic updates'.
- Enter the frequency (in minutes) with which you want PureMessage to check for updated software.
- Click 'OK'
